def get_value(obj, key):
"""
Convenience function to retrive a value by name from the given
object. This will first try to assume the object is a dict but
will fallback to using ``getattr()`` on it.
:param obj: Arbitrary dict or object of any kind which would have
named attributes.
:param key: Key/name of the field to get.
:returns: Whatever value is found. Or maybe an ``AttributeError``
is raised if the object does not have the key/attr set.
"""
# nb. we try dict access first, since wutta data model objects
# should all support that anyway, so it's 2 birds 1 stone.
try:
return obj[key]
except (KeyError, TypeError):
# nb. key error means the object supports key lookup (i.e. is
# dict-like) but did not have that key set. which is actually
# an expected scenario for association proxy fields, but for
# those a getattr() should still work; see also
# wuttjamaican.db.util.ModelBase
return getattr(obj, key)
